175 cm in Health and Fitness
In the realm of health and fitness, 175 cm is a significant measurement for calculating BMI. BMI is a widely used metric to determine whether a person is underweight, normal weight, overweight, or obese. The formula for BMI is weight (in kilograms) divided by the square of height (in meters). For someone who is 175 cm tall, the height in meters is 1.75. This measurement is crucial for healthcare professionals to assess a person's health risks and provide appropriate advice.
For example, if a person who is 175 cm tall weighs 70 kilograms, their BMI would be calculated as follows:
| Weight (kg) | Height (m) | BMI |
|---|---|---|
| 70 | 1.75 | 22.86 |
This BMI falls within the normal range, indicating a healthy weight for someone who is 175 cm tall. However, if the weight were higher or lower, the BMI would indicate whether the person is at risk of health issues related to being overweight or underweight.
